Prize Money: The Cornerstone of Snooker Earnings
The most direct and significant contributor to a snooker player’s wealth is their prize money from tournaments. The sport’s governing body, World Snooker Tour, organizes a calendar of prestigious events throughout the year, each with its own prize fund. These range from major ranking tournaments like the World Championship, the UK Championship, and The Masters, to smaller Players Championship events and invitation tournaments. The amounts awarded can be substantial, particularly for winners and those who progress deep into the later stages of these competitions.
Kyren Wilson, often referred to as “The Warrior” for his determined play, has consistently performed well in these events. His career has seen him reach numerous finals, including the prestigious World Championship final in 2020. Each of these deep runs translates into significant prize money. For instance, winning the World Championship comes with a hefty seven-figure sum, while reaching the final, as Wilson did, still nets a considerable amount. Similarly, winning major events like the Masters or the UK Championship offers substantial financial rewards.
It’s important to note that prize money is often tiered. The winner takes home the largest chunk, but substantial amounts are awarded to quarter-finalists, semi-finalists, and even players reaching the last 16. This means that consistent high-level performance is crucial for maximizing earnings. A player like Wilson, who regularly features in the latter stages of tournaments, will accumulate a substantial amount of prize money over the course of a season and his career.

Player Expenses
It’s important to remember that professional snooker players incur significant expenses. These include:
- Travel and Accommodation: Players travel extensively throughout the year for tournaments, incurring costs for flights, hotels, and meals.
- Coaching and Training: Many players invest in professional coaching and training facilities to maintain their edge.
- Equipment: High-quality cues and other playing equipment can be expensive.
- Management Fees: Agents and managers typically take a percentage of a player’s earnings.
While Kyren Wilson is undoubtedly wealthy, these expenses are a reality of professional sports and need to be factored into any assessment of his net worth. However, for a player of his caliber, the income generated far outweighs these costs.

Why is it difficult to determine a precise net worth for snooker players?
Determining a precise net worth for snooker players, or indeed any celebrity, is challenging for several reasons:
1. Private Financial Information: The financial details of endorsement deals, sponsorship agreements, and personal investments are almost always kept private. Players and their representatives do not publicly disclose the exact figures they earn from these sources. This lack of transparency makes it impossible to calculate an exact net worth. What is often reported are estimates based on industry averages, media coverage, and the player’s perceived market value.
2. Fluctuating Income: A significant portion of a snooker player’s income comes from tournament prize money, which is inherently variable. Success in tournaments can fluctuate from season to season based on form, health, and the competitive landscape. This means that annual earnings can differ substantially, making it difficult to pinpoint a fixed net worth at any given moment.
3. Expenses and Investments: A player’s net worth is not just their gross income; it’s their assets minus their liabilities. Players incur significant expenses related to travel, accommodation, coaching, equipment, and management fees. Furthermore, their investment strategies, including the performance of their assets, are private. A player might have substantial earnings but also significant investments or debts, which are not publicly known.
4. Varying Reporting Standards: Different financial publications and websites may use different methodologies and sources for their estimates. Some might focus more heavily on prize money, while others attempt to factor in a range of endorsement values. This can lead to discrepancies in reported net worth figures across various sources.
5. Time Lag in Information: Even publicly reported figures for prize money or major deals might have a time lag. Official record-keeping might be slightly behind real-time earnings, and estimates of endorsements are often based on past trends rather than current, precise contracts.
In essence, the estimations of snooker players’ net worth are educated guesses based on available public data and industry knowledge, rather than exact financial accounting. They provide a general understanding of a player’s financial success but should be viewed as approximations.
